Output 76315409dc3591dbc39da49a75b32887be144bc9194087e9a57d7b3ff417f978:35

value
1821981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c6a156c0c030f6be7b5ba7a15a446cf9d1f6a94 OP_EQUAL
address
37CTYsp5DUfVzA6ymcYd8oDn3zNmaJwPDG
transaction
76315409dc3591dbc39da49a75b32887be144bc9194087e9a57d7b3ff417f978
confirmations
243766
spent
true